BORSARI Food Company Incorporated Recalled by Borsari Food Company Inc Due to Undeclared Fish
What You Should Do
Stop using this product immediately. Do not consume, use, or distribute it.
Return the product to the place of purchase for a full refund. If you have questions, contact Borsari Food Company Inc directly.
Affected Products
BORSARI Food Company Incorporated; BLOODY MARY MIX ; 32 FL. OZ; INGREDIENTS: Tomato juice, corn syrup, non-fat milk solids, orange juice, lemon juice, lime juice, cayenne pepper, vinegar, salt, garlic powder, Worcestershire sauce, prepared horseradish, maltic acid, sodium and potassium benzoate, yellow 5 & 6; UPC: 815893000101
Quantity: 5,818 units
Why Was This Recalled?
Product contains undeclared fish (anchovy) and soy.
Where Was This Sold?
This product was distributed to 25 states: AL, AZ, CA, CT, FL, GA, IL, IN, KS, MD, MA, MI, MN, MT, NM, NY, OH, PA, RI, SC, SD, TN, UT, VA, WA
